On December 3, 2025, Yalla Na’mar Baladna Women’s Association, in partnership with the Community Development Organization, organized a health education workshop in the Al-Ta’alaba area of Adila locality in East Darfur. The workshop saw active participation from leading women, young women, and displaced women, and was part of the association’s project which includes a health education workshop and the provision of a solar power system to operate the laboratory and store medicine at the Al-Ta’alaba Health Center.
This is within the framework of the project to mitigate the effects of war on those affected by the conflict in South and East Darfur, Phase Four.
